I made this website to extract acapellas from any song for free (no signup). Just upload your song as mp3, wait a minute or two and download the isolated vocals.

Of course the result is not as clean as studio recordings but it can do the job to demo tracks or remixes and creative samping.

Hope some of you find this usefull